What is a 220 4 Prong Plug Wiring Diagram and How is it Used?
A 220 4 Prong Plug Wiring Diagram specifically details how to connect a four-pronged plug that supplies 220-volt power. Unlike older three-prong plugs, these four-prong configurations are designed for modern appliances that demand more robust electrical connections, including a separate ground wire for enhanced safety. These are commonly found on appliances like electric dryers, ranges, and some powerful air conditioning units that draw significant amperage. The diagram clearly illustrates the function and connection point for each of the four prongs, which typically include two hot wires, one neutral wire, and one ground wire.
The importance of following the 220 4 Prong Plug Wiring Diagram accurately cannot be overstated. Miswiring can lead to appliance damage, electrical shock, or even fire hazards. The diagram acts as a visual guide, mapping out the flow of electricity and ensuring that the correct wires are connected to their designated terminals. Here’s a breakdown of what you typically find:
- L1 (Hot Wire 1): Carries one leg of the 220V power.
- L2 (Hot Wire 2): Carries the second leg of the 220V power.
- N (Neutral Wire): Provides a return path for the current.
- G (Ground Wire): A safety wire that provides a path for electricity to flow to the ground in case of a fault.
Understanding the physical layout of the plug itself is also key. The four slots on the plug are designed to accept specific prongs, and the wiring diagram shows which color wire from your appliance or power cord connects to each terminal within the outlet or plug. For instance, a typical wiring configuration might look like this:
| Prong/Terminal | Wire Color (Common) | Function |
|---|---|---|
| L1 | Black | Hot |
| L2 | Red | Hot |
| N | White | Neutral |
| G | Green or Bare Copper | Ground |
Always consult the specific appliance manual and local electrical codes in addition to the diagram. A proper understanding of the 220 4 Prong Plug Wiring Diagram ensures that you are making safe and compliant connections, protecting both your equipment and your household.
